Article 23: Job Descriptions
- Copies of job descriptions shall be on hand within the appropriate department(s) and shall be available to each Employee upon request.
-
- Upon request, the Employer will provide the Union with a copy of a job description for any classification in the bargaining unit provided that a request for a particular job description is not made more than once in a calendar year.
- The Employer will provide the Union with an updated copy of job descriptions for all classifications in the bargaining unit at least once every five (5) years.
- If it is determined that a job description does not exist or has been altered or amended, the Employer shall prepare and provide the job description within ninety (90) days of initial request for the job description.
